Location Profile:
Novelis’ Global Corporate Headquarters is located in the Buckhead neighborhood of Atlanta Georgia and employs approximately 250 people. It is co-located with Novelis’ North America regional office which employs approximately 225 people. Supporting its 24 operations worldwide Novelis’ corporate office is home to the executive leadership team and global functions that support the automotive beverage can and high-end specialties value streams.
